ArnoSync control panel
The idea is that pressing the button cycles the system through idle, set up mode and shooting mode. The red LED flashes in idle and lights up in set up mode. While in set up mode, the yellow LED indicates the strength of the return signal from the detector. The green shooting mode LED flashes while the shutter capacitor is charging, and is steady when the shutter is ready. The intention for the white LED is to provide a flash ready indication.
The board also has test points: 0volts (ground), laser drive and shutter trigger, though these can be changed by changing connections inside the circuit housing.
